Chelsea target Yoshinori Muto lived up to his billing with the winning goal as FC Tokyo beat Shonan Bellmare 1-0 on Sunday to move joint-top of the J. League table.

All eyes were on Muto at BMW Stadium after Tokyo president Naoki Ogane revealed earlier in the week that Premier League leader Chelsea had made a formal offer for the 22-year-old.

Muto, who spent the early part of the week recovering from neck and back injuries, did not disappoint, heading home a Kosuke Ota cross in the 64th minute to give Tokyo an identical record to Urawa Reds in first place after Urawa drew 1-1 with Kawasaki Frontale.
